Understanding Traffic Message Boards
In addition to dynamic lighting, the role of a traffic message board cannot be overstated. These crucial components of urban traffic management relay important messages such as accident alerts, weather advisories, and construction notices that help drivers make informed decisions. Having timely information fosters an environment of safety by mitigating panic and confusion amongst motorists. In this age of technological advancement, these boards are essential for facilitating efficient travel and reducing congestion on our roadways.
